The Advantages of Cast Aluminum Parts


In the world of modern manufacturing, the use of cast aluminum parts has gained significant popularity due to their unique combination of durability, lightweight nature, and versatility. From automotive components to aerospace applications, cast aluminum parts are preferred for various industrial uses. Understanding the advantages of these components can help businesses make informed decisions regarding their manufacturing processes.


Lightweight Yet Strong


One of the most significant benefits of cast aluminum parts is their remarkable strength-to-weight ratio. Aluminum is much lighter than steel and other metals, making it an ideal choice for applications where weight reduction is crucial. For instance, in the automotive industry, lighter vehicles contribute to improved fuel efficiency, leading to lower emissions and reduced operational costs. Despite being lightweight, cast aluminum parts are highly durable and can withstand harsh environmental conditions, making them suitable for outdoor applications as well.


Excellent Machinability


Cast aluminum can be easily machined, allowing for the production of complex components with precise dimensions. This characteristic is particularly important in industries where precise tolerances are essential, such as in aerospace engineering. The machinability of cast aluminum also means that it can be quickly and efficiently processed, reducing the overall production time and costs. This advantage allows manufacturers to meet tight deadlines and maintain competitive pricing.


Corrosion Resistance

Another notable feature of cast aluminum parts is their inherent corrosion resistance. When exposed to the elements, aluminum naturally forms a protective oxide layer that helps shield it from corrosion and wear. This property makes cast aluminum a preferred choice for outdoor and marine applications, where exposure to moisture and environmental factors can significantly impact the longevity of a component. This durability translates to lower maintenance costs and longer lifespans for products made from cast aluminum.


Design Flexibility


The casting process allows for a high degree of design flexibility, enabling manufacturers to create intricate shapes and configurations that would be challenging with other materials. This flexibility opens up a world of possibilities for designers and engineers, allowing them to innovate and push the boundaries of product design. Whether it's creating lightweight brackets or complex housings, cast aluminum parts can meet a variety of design requirements while maintaining structural integrity.


Sustainability


Lastly, cast aluminum parts are highly recyclable, making them an environmentally friendly choice. The recycling process for aluminum consumes only a fraction of the energy required to produce new aluminum, significantly reducing the carbon footprint associated with aluminum production. As sustainability becomes a driving force in manufacturing, the use of cast aluminum parts aligns with global efforts to promote environmentally sustainable practices.
